[Utilities] Deep copy null
as null
. Display object type in varDump
This commit is contained in:
parent
7a8e06cac2
commit
9d8869cd33
1 changed files with 2 additions and 2 deletions
|
@ -914,7 +914,7 @@ Zotero.Utilities = {
|
|||
for(var i in obj) {
|
||||
if(!obj.hasOwnProperty(i)) continue;
|
||||
|
||||
if(typeof obj[i] === "object") {
|
||||
if(typeof obj[i] === "object" && obj[i] !== null) {
|
||||
obj2[i] = Zotero.Utilities.deepCopy(obj[i]);
|
||||
} else {
|
||||
obj2[i] = obj[i];
|
||||
|
@ -1139,7 +1139,7 @@ Zotero.Utilities = {
|
|||
closeBrace = ']';
|
||||
}
|
||||
|
||||
dumped_text += level_padding + "'" + item + "' => " + openBrace;
|
||||
dumped_text += level_padding + "'" + item + "' => " + type + ' ' + openBrace;
|
||||
//only recurse if there's anything in the object, purely cosmetical
|
||||
try {
|
||||
for(var i in value) {
|
||||
|
|
Loading…
Add table
Reference in a new issue